Job Overview
  • As a Network Support Specialist within Client's Network Management Center (NMC), candidate will be integral to the monitoring of the Client's Mobility & IP network, ensuring seamless cellular mobile services on cruise ships worldwide.
  • This role involves maintaining the reliability and optimal performance of Client's network infrastructure, encompassing the Transport Network (Cisco Switching & Routing), Mobility Network (Ericsson RAN/Core devices for UMTS, LTE and 5G, as well as DAS), and IoT solution for Container ships.
  • Candidate's duties will include monitoring network activities, diagnosing and resolving issues, and delivering technical support to both internal and external st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ities •Network Monitoring o Utilize network monitoring tools to continuously observe network performance and identify potential issues. o Respond promptly to alerts and incidents, conducting initial troubleshooting to determine the root cause of network problems. •Issue Resolution o Diagnose and resolve network incidents, collaborating with cross-functional teams to implement effective solutions. o Document troubleshooting steps, resolutions, and maintain a comprehensive knowledge base for future reference. •Technical Support o Provide timely and effective technical support to end-users and internal teams experiencing network-related problems. o Communicate technical information clearly to both technical and non-technical audiences. •Configuration and Maintenance o Assist in the configuration, installation, and maintenance of network equipment, including routers, switches, and firewalls. •Collaboration o Collaborate with network engineers and other IT professionals to maintain, implement, and optimize network infrastructure. o Participate in cross-functional teams to implement new technologies and address evolving business requirements. •Documentation o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of network config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ting processes. o Contribute to the development of standard operating procedures (SOPs) to enhance network management efficiency. •Emergency Response o Act promptly during critical situations, providing support in the event of network outages or emergencies. o Work closely with the Network Management Center (NMC) SMEs, Lead and Manager to escalate and coordinate responses to high-priority incidents.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Telecommunications, Computer Science, or relevant professional experience.
  • Demonstrated expertise in IP network support and/or cellular network support, with a preference for experience in a NOC environment.
  • Proficiency in utilizing network monitoring tools and diagnostic utilities, such as Solarwinds, PRTG, Nemo Analyze, etc.
  • Exceptional tro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
  • Familiarity with Cisco switches and routers, VMware, ESXI, and other networking equipment.
  • Knowledge of cellular network infrastructure (RAN and Core) for UMTS, LTE, and 5G technologies.
  • Familiarity with IoT, RF engineering/optimization, and DAS (Distributed Antenna System) is beneficial.
  • Possession of relevant certifications (e.g., CCENT, CCNA) is advantageous.
